CellReport、AJ-report和FineReport怎么选?最新对比测评来袭!
作者:finereport
浏览:7,384
发布时间:2023.11.6
如今,数据分析和可视化报告基本上是中大型企业数据应用的标配了,企业信息化下一步就是数字化,数字化之前需要先适应数据化管理,那么可视化报表就是一个很好的应用场景,将企业数据呈现出来,用于日常监控和决策。
那么如何选择专业的报告生成软件呢?开源报表里头,CellReport、AJ-report提的比较多,商业报表软件里FineReport应用最广,接下来本文将对它们进行全面的对比测评,以帮助您选择最适合您的需求的软件。
1.功能对比
CellReport
CellReport 致力于解决日常快速制作统计报表的需求。CellReport抛弃原有的使用存储过程加工数据的方式, 结合集合运算的思想,使得报表制作人员专注于每一类指标的加工。
CellReport 支持使用集合函数来组织数据,使报表制作和维护更为便捷。
AJ-report
AJ-Report是全开源的一个BI平台,主要宣传点是酷炫的展示大屏。有如下特点:
- 多数据源支持,内置mysql、elasticsearch、kudu驱动,支持自定义数据集省去数据接口开发
- 提供30多种大屏组件或图表模板
- 三步轻松完成大屏设计:配置数据源---->写SQL配置数据集---->拖拽配置大屏---->保存发布
FineReport
FineReport是一款基于Java开发的企业级报表和数据可视化工具 ,结合了CellReport和AJ-report的功能,既支持复杂报表制作,也支持可视化的酷炫大屏。具有以下主要特点:
- 强大的数据分析和可视化功能,支持可视化数据钻取,数据切片和数据旋转等多维分析操作。
- 多种数据源连接方式,提供基于SQL的数据库直连引擎,支持大数据平台的大数据量的访问,实时数据分析。
- 高度可定制的报表模板和样式,支持一键套用,省时省力。
- 可以通过拖拽、点击等简单操作,快速生成各类报表和数据可视化界面。
- 该系统具有报表分析、数据挖掘、财务分析、预算管理、成本控制等多种功能,有效解决数据孤岛问题,完全能够满足企业财务管理的需要。
- 项目实施周期短,人员学习成本低,性价比高
2.性能对比
CellReport
由于CellReport受限于Excel终端展示,对于小型和中型数据集,它的性能表现良好。但是,对于大型数据集和复杂的报告,它的性能可能会受到限制。
AJ-report
AJ-report的部署和扩展受限于版本,已知版本兼容性问题(摘自官网):
- IE白屏(兼容性问题)
- Node.js V16及以上
- openJdk
- Jdk 1.7及以下/11及以上(jdk11部分版本有问题)
- Mysql 8.0(8.0.23/26版本没有问题,8.0.21版本存在问题)
FineReport
- 数据处理和查询优化:FineReport通过对数据查询和处理的优化,提高了报表的生成速度和响应性能。它使用了一些技术手段,如缓存机制、数据预加载等,以减少数据库查询次数和数据传输量,从而提升报表生成的效率。
- 并发处理和负载均衡:FineReport支持多用户并发访问和报表生成,具备一定的并发处理能力。它可以通过负载均衡的方式将请求分发到多个服务器上,提高系统的整体处理能力和响应时间。
- 缓存机制和数据重用:FineReport提供了缓存机制,可以将报表数据缓存在内存中,以减少重复查询和计算的开销。这样可以提高报表的反应速度,特别是对于需要频繁刷新的报表或大数据量的报表。
- 数据源优化和索引支持:FineReport对于不同的数据源,提供了一些优化策略和技术支持。它可以针对具体的数据库类型,使用相应的查询优化技术,如索引等,以提高查询性能和数据检索速度。
3.安全性
FineReport提供了多种安全性功能,包括数据加密、访问控制、安全审计和单点登录等。它还提供了与现有安全系统集成的选项。
4.价格对比
CellReport
CellReport是国产开源系统,可以通过github获取资源。
AJ-report
AJ-Report使用Apache2.0开源协议,允许商业使用,但务必保留类作者、Copyright信息。个人和企业可以直接使用。
FineReport
FineReport个人版免费使用(个人版是针对用户个人的报表工具,没有功能阉割,永久免费!),企业商用版收费,具体价格看功能需求。
总结
相比较来说,CellReport侧重于日常报表快速制作,AJ-report主要是提供可视化展示,而FineReport作为中国市场上非常成熟的一款报表工具,提供了非常广泛的功能,同时也被Gartner在其BI市场指南中推荐,是最适合企业使用的商业报表工具。
报表工具产品更多介绍:www.finereport.com